Easy Pigs in a Blanket – Golden, Flaky, and Perfect for Any Party

🧰 Equipment Needed

  • Baking sheet
  • Parchment paper
  • Knife or pizza cutter
  • Mixing bowl (optional, for egg wash)
  • Pastry brush (optional)

🛒 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 1 package beef or chicken mini sausages
  • 1 package refrigerated crescent roll dough or puff pastry

Optional Finish

  •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
  • Sesame seeds or poppy seeds (optional)

👩‍🍳 Directions

Follow these easy steps to make perfect pigs in a blanket.

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

  • Preheat your oven to 190°C (375°F).
  •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Step 2: Prepare the Dough

  • Unroll the crescent dough or puff pastry.
  • Cut into small triangles or strips wide enough to wrap the sausages.

Step 3: Wrap the Sausages

  • Place one sausage at the wide end of each dough piece.
  • Roll up tightly, tucking the ends slightly underneath.
  • Place seam-side down on the baking sheet.

Step 4: Optional Egg Wash

  • Brush the tops lightly with beaten egg for extra golden color.
  • Sprinkle with sesame or poppy seeds if desired.

Step 5: Bake

  •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the pastry is puffed and golden brown.
  • Remove from the oven and let cool slightly.

Step 6: Serve

  • Serve warm as-is or with your favorite dipping sauces.

🍽️ Servings & Timing

  • Servings: About 20–24 pieces
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Bake Time: 12–15 minutes
  • Total Time: About 25 minutes

Perfect for last-minute entertaining.


🧊 Storage & Reheating

Storage

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Reheating

  • Reheat in the oven or air fryer at 180°C (350°F) until warm and crisp.
  • Avoid microwaving to keep the pastry flaky.

Make-Ahead Tip

  • Assemble ahead and refrigerate; bake just before serving.

🥄 Variations

Customize your pigs in a blanket easily:

  • Cheesy Version: Add a small slice of cheese before rolling.
  • Spicy Kick: Use spicy beef or chicken sausages.
  • Everything Topping: Sprinkle everything seasoning before baking.
  • Mini Wraps: Cut smaller for bite-size party trays.
  • Air Fryer: Cook at 180°C (350°F) for 8–10 minutes.

10 FAQs

  1. What sausages work best?
    Beef or chicken mini sausages are ideal.
  2. Can I use puff pastry instead of crescent dough?
    Yes, both work beautifully.
  3. Do I need egg wash?
    It’s optional but adds shine and color.
  4. Can kids help make these?
    Absolutely, wrapping is fun and easy.
  5. Can I freeze them?
    Freeze unbaked, then bake from frozen with extra time.
  6. Are these good for parties?
    Yes, they’re a classic crowd favorite.
  7. How do I keep them warm?
    Use a low oven or warming tray.
  8. Can I double the recipe?
    Yes, perfect for large gatherings.
  9. What dips go well?
    Mustard-style dips, ketchup, or creamy sauces.
  10. Can I make them crispier?
    Bake a few extra minutes until deeply golden.
